Concerns of Bank’s business contacts underline challenge Brexit poses for Britain’s powerhouse services sector

 

Commenting on the findings published today (Wednesday) in the Bank of England’s Agents’ Summary of Business Conditions report, Matt Whittaker, Chief Economist at the Resolution Foundation, said:

“Concerns raised by firms in today’s report underlines the big challenge Brexit poses for the services sector, which is being hit by a loss of confidence without benefiting from weaker sterling.

“In the short term, we’re seeing the first signs that the current economic uncertainty is feeding through into people’s job prospects, particularly in the services sector. The even bigger challenge facing these firms is how Britain negotiates its trading relationship with Europe. Losing access to the single market could lead to a large, permanent shock to Britain’s powerhouse services sector.

“British trade policy has gone from being the long-forgotten man of public policy to one of the most important determinants of our future economic prospects.”
